The last player to score 40 in the top flight was Jimmy Greaves back in 1960/61 (41goals)!
I would be surprised if he doesn't get past that this year.
The record obviously is Dixie Dean's incredible 60 back in 1927/28... can he get to that?

It's fascinating watching him play. His anticipation is supernatural. He's almost always in the six yard box, never on his heels, always moving unerringly to near or far post depending on the situation unfolding, always has his eye on the ball. He looks like he spends his day thinking about scoring goals, sleeps solidly at night dreaming of scoring goals, eats goals for breakfast, and his only thought in a game is getting into position to score as many goals as he can. No flicks and tricks, no admiring himself, no whining and flapping, just 100% get in the box, score, get in the box, score, get in the box, score.
